After 25 months my Golf R hatch went back to Lease Plan this morning. The inspector was (very) thorough, but fair. They take a bunch of pictures on an tablet and print a report out from a printer in the boot of their car which is quite cool. Its all done and dusted while they are there, there is no further inspection or possibility of a bill later down the line.

Inky81 said:
Did you get charged for any damage reclaim from LP? My Audi goes back to them Tuesday (when the R arrives) and although in relatively good condition there are a couple of less than perfect alloys etc....
No charges. Two of my alloys were curbed, slightly. I think you are allowed up to one 10cm curb rash mark per alloy. Any more than that and they will probably recharge some damage.
